Output dfaecf675984e7d1b97a472f7999e4fddf7404f7d2fc1b2226ffc757d6b90338:85

value
2620910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6533aea4eb0f65c9f0985bfa8cc8b2e88afa384c OP_EQUAL
address
3Av85ru2bcQE4s4oZHLD2dyB6X1aWyuog8
transaction
dfaecf675984e7d1b97a472f7999e4fddf7404f7d2fc1b2226ffc757d6b90338
spent
true